Charlie is evaluating the product of 0.09 and 0.05. He multiplies, and before placing the decimal, arrives at an answer of 45. A

fter considering the decimal placement, what is Charlie’s final answer?
0.0045
0.045
0.45
0.4545
edgenuity 2020 PLEASE HELP IM DOING A TEST
Mathematics
2 answers:
almond37 [142]2 years ago
6 0
The answer is .0045 because you move the decimal place 4 times to the left.
STatiana [176]2 years ago
4 0
0.09 x 0.05= 0.0045

An article reports that 1 in 500 people carry the defective gene that causes inherited colon cancer. In a sample of 2500 individ
Ne4ueva [31]

Answer:

The approximate distribution of the number who carry this gene is approximately normal with mean \mu = 5 and standard deviation \sigma = 2.23

Step-by-step explanation:

For each person, there are only two possible outcomes. Either they carry the defective gene that causes inherited colon cancer, or they do not. The probability of a person carrying this gene is independent from other people. So the binomial probability distribution is used to solve this question.

A sample of 2500 individuals is quite large, so we use the binomial approximation to the normal to solve this question.

Binomial probability distribution

Probability of exactly x sucesses on n repeated trials, with p probability.

Can be approximated to a normal distribution, using the expected value and the standard deviation.

The expected value of the binomial distribution is:

E(X) = np

The standard deviation of the binomial distribution is:

\sqrt{V(X)} = \sqrt{np(1-p)}

Normal probability distribution

Problems of normally distributed samples can be solved using the z-score formula.

In a set with mean \mu and standard deviation \sigma, the zscore of a measure X is given by:

Z = \frac{X - \mu}{\sigma}

The Z-score measures how many standard deviations the measure is from the mean. After finding the Z-score, we look at the z-score table and find the p-value associated with this z-score. This p-value is the probability that the value of the measure is smaller than X, that is, the percentile of X. Subtracting 1 by the pvalue, we get the probability that the value of the measure is greater than X.

When we are approximating a binomial distribution to a normal one, we have that \mu = E(X), \sigma = \sqrt{V(X)}.

An article reports that 1 in 500 people carry the defective gene that causes inherited colon cancer.

This means that p = \frac{1}{500} = 0.002

In a sample of 2500 individuals, what is the approximate distribution of the number who carry this gene?

n = 2500

So

\mu = E(X) = np = 2500*0.002 = 5

\sigma = \sqrt{V(X)} = \sqrt{np(1-p)} = \sqrt{2500*0.002*0.998} = 2.23

So the approximate distribution of the number who carry this gene is approximately normal with mean \mu = 5 and standard deviation \sigma = 2.23
